This is Early Childhood Educators week. The week celebrates the significant role early childhood educators play in the lives of children in guiding their learning and development. More than 2,000 people hold Child Care Services Certification and work in child care centres, family child care homes, family resource centres, educational institutions, businesses, and not-for-profit organizations in communities throughout the province. The Department of Education is developing a recruitment and retention program tailored specifically for early childhood educators, and has added 700 post-secondary seats to education programs. Education Minister John Haggie says, “The knowledge and expertise they bring to the profession is admirable and provides essential learning support for children.”
